Admission, Enrollment, and Graduation

Total 4,294 students are attending at Durham Technical Community College. There are 134 full-time faculty (instructional/teaching staffs) and 363 part-time faculty teaching for the school.
The students to faculty ratio is 6 to 1 (16.67%). The number of non-teaching staffs is 356 (full-time) and 446 (part-time).
The graduation rate of Durham Technical Community College is 23% and transfer-out rate is 23%. The retention rate is 66% at the school.

For the academic year 2021-2022, total 4,119 students enrolled into Durham Technical Community College. By gender, 1,518 male and 2,601 female students are attending the school.

There are 1,352 White (32.82%), 1,249 Black/African American (30.32%), 753 Hispanic (18.28%), 207 Asian (5.03%), and 1,309 students with other races attending Durham Technical Community College. 192 students are enrolled with non-resident alien status.
